>>97269950Cons: >Requires system mastery to flow correctly. Especially combat.>Combat maneuvers become a bit solved with pcs always choosing the target location special ability to dog pile damage and incapacitate an enemy. (i have had to homebrew around that)>Focus on simulationism even more than other d100 games might feel overly constraining.>it is more of a toolkit system as far as magic is concerned especially.>piles a lot on the gm to get it running properly.>character creation is kinda flawed and deigned towards making you mediocre at 5-10 things.Generally a lot of constrains when creating characters feels like an over correction more than anything. >Combat style is inherently superior to other combat skills like evade, endurance and willpower which are your resistances>action point system is kinda gamey and hardlocks you a little bit into mostly defending if numerically disadvantaged >lack of gm advice and procedures for dungeoncrawling, hexploration, sandbox play even if it was large part of the oldschool d100systems with settings like griffin island, especially considering that all the tools for such a style of play are there and the d100 is probably the only other game that can do that as well as the osr>armor is a little weaker than it should be.>the way xp rolls are gained is just worse and more gamey than the other organic ways used in d100 systemsComment too long. Christmas edition▶What is Kingdom Death?Kingdom Death is a tabletop miniature brand stared by Adam Poots and operated by himself and his Team that later spun off into a miniature based bored game funded by two very successful Kickstarter campaigns.▶What is Kingdom Death: Monster?Monster is a Nightmare Horror cooperative boss battler/miniature hobby game for 1-4 players about hope in a strange world of bizarre monstrosities and perpetually darkness. Players take on the role of survivors that band together to form a settlement, fighting monsters, crafting weapons and gear, and developing their civilization to ensure survival from generation to generation.Prologue Narration: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=FNLc8dHv0AcThe Game is broken up into 3 phases:1. During your Hunt Phase your band of survivors traverse the world of KD in pursuit of their quarry.2. After successfully tracking your quarry you will begin the Showdown Phase, where you must fell these horrific creatures in order to acquire precious resources.3. After the battle, your survivors wander home with loot in hand to begin the Settlement Phase. Arm yourself by developing new weapons and bizarre structures to prepare for next year's hunt.Comment too long. Click here to view the full text.
